PDA

View Full Version : مشکل نوشتن در جدول های MySql



nasr
یک شنبه 10 آبان 1383, 15:20 عصر
سلام
من با این کد به MySql وصل می شم و می خوام که در جدول Phon و در فیلدهای Name و Phon جملات Ali و 123را اضافه کنه ولی نمی کنه

<?php
$host ='localhost';
$username = 'root';
$pasword = '';
$databasename = 'amin';

$connection = mysql_connect($host,$username,$pasword);

mysql_select_db($databasename,$connection);

$sql = "insert into phon (name,phon) value ('Ali','123')";

mysql_query($sql,$connection);
mysql_close($connection);
?>
ممنون

Spoofed
یک شنبه 10 آبان 1383, 15:26 عصر
بنویس VALUES بجای value :D

nasr
دوشنبه 11 آبان 1383, 08:32 صبح
سلام
این مشکلم حل شد و متشکرم
من می خوام که آمار بازدید کنندگان "امروز" "دیروز" و "از اول تا حالا" را به کاربر نشون بدم
یه جدولی در MYSql ساختم با نام dbamar که شامل فیلدهای Date_rooz و Tedad است
اول اینکه چگونه میشه تاریخ امروز را وارد جدول کرد من با این کد عمل کردم نشد
$d = date();
$sql = "insert into amar (date_rooz,tedad) values ('$d','1')";
حالا با این کد برای اولین بار تاریخ امروز و عدد 1 وارد جدول شده و یه رکورد اضافه میشه (اگه اشتباه نکنم)
دوم اینکه: حالا چطور می تونم به جای عدد 1 کد زیر را بنویسم

"select tedad , max(date_rooz) from amar group by date_rooz , tedad "
تا ماکزیمم تاریخ که همون تاریخ امروز میشه و عدد داخل فیلد Tedad را برگردونه و به علاوه 1 کنه و ... :متفکر:
ممنون :roll: